Acer decreases notebook and Tablet PC shipments forecast

Teaser
The company has reportedly faced increasing competition from Apple's iPad, blames the European economy as well

The Taiwanese PC manufacturer, Acer, has apparently decided to lower its forecast for notebook and tablet shipments. Despite the company’s high expectations for 2011, the slowly recovering European economy and the fierce competition (iPad) are reportedly among the reasons for the revised forecast.

According to Acer chairman J.T. Wang, the company will ship between 2.5 and 3 million units by the end of this year, which is about 50% less than the previously expected 5-7 million units. Mr. Wang has supposedly also stated that present quarter laptop shipments will plunge by 10% from Q1 2011 and should become more stable and even go up in Q3 2011.
